Abstract

In example embodiments, a semantic multimodal search function is provided in an engineering application for searching engineering documents. In an indexing phase, the application indexes a library of engineering documents to build an embedding database. For each of the engineering documents, a region detector extracts regions that each correspond to a different mode of technical or engineering data, and a set of ML models is used to generate embeddings that represent the semantic significance of technical or engineering data in each of the regions. In a query phase, the application receives search input and uses the region detector to extract regions that each correspond to a different mode of input. The application uses the ML models to generate embeddings that represent the semantic significance of input in each of the regions, and then performs a vector search between these embeddings and those in the embedding database.
